Tried both their number #35 and #52. 35 is a combination of everything which includes grilled pork, shrimp , egg rolls and shrimp balls which are just like fish cake. This is served on rice noodles. 52 was awesome as it's toasted chicken served with fried sticky rice. I would highly recommend to try this dish. Their fish sauce is really good.

    You won't find any pho here . My favorite soup is Bún bò Huế , and this place does it well . If you're not familiar you gotta give it a try . Think more along the lines of menudo vs pho . Pork Bone , tender thinly sliced beef & a deep clear / red semi spicy soup broth . Sides of delicious herbs , cilantro & basil & im not even sure what one of them is but it has a citrus flavor . The place was very clean & the service was excellent

It's pretty much a hole in the wall type of place with some large TV's on the walls if you wanted to watch sporting events like the World Cup. We got banh mi pate que which comes with 2 piece that are breadstick sized filled with pate and pork floss. A great appetizer for sharing or having some coffee with. It comes served piping HOT so be careful! We also had the bun cha ha noi which is a very traditional Northern Vietnamese Nanoi dish. It has grilled pork patties and pork belly in a sweet savory fish sauce served with fresh herbs and cold rice vermicelli. You pretty much eat it by wrapping it with the lettuce or dip your noodles into the sauce. Very authentic and delicious without being overly heavy. There isn't much service here since they seem to be super short staffed but they do have delicious authentic Northern Vietnamese food so we absolutely will be back again!
